Top 7 JavaScript trends to follow and apply in 2021

Posted by olivia cuthbert on April 27th, 2021

                 

JavaScript will still be one of the most popular and studied programming languages in 2020. According to Stack Overflow's survey, JavaScript tops the list of most popular technologies. Nearly 70% of professional developers worldwide use this programming language. Its popularity base on its simplicity and the wide range of applications developed in JavaScript, from web development to cross-browser environments.

Next year, JavaScript expects to remain at its peak, and demand for JavaScript development services will be high. This article looks at seven key JavaScript trends to watch and implement in 2021 and why you should implement them in your projects.

Although TypeScript was released in 2012, it became the programming language of hype in 2019-2020. TypeScript acts as an extension to JavaScript, allowing the creation of complex applications for client-side and server-side execution. Many software developers prefer TypeScript because it is highly standardized, easy to read, and simple to debug. It supports a wide range of IDEs and can convert to JavaScript at any time.

Stack Overflow ranked Typescript as one of the top three programming languages. And according to GitHub statistics, its popularity continues to grow as the community expands.

#2 React.js remains popular

JavaScript offers a wide range of frameworks for fast and efficient application development, leaving software developers confused about which one is best suited for a particular project. Many of them choose React.js because it allows them to create robust and easily scalable web and mobile solutions.

According to Stack Overflow's rating, React.js is the number one framework for web development. According to map trends, React.js is growing in popularity among app developers, with 9 million downloads by November 2020.

Many famous web and mobile apps have built using React.js, including Facebook, Instagram, Netflix, WhatsApp, Discovery, NY Times, and many more. React.js is constantly growing, adding new features and attracting a wider audience. As a result, we expect to see even more applications based on React.js in 2021.

#3 Vue.js will continue to rise

Vue.js is a JavaScript framework that was recently released. It was first released in 2014 and had been spreading quite rapidly among web application developers since then. Stack Overflow ranked it as the second most popular web development framework in 2019, and trends reported nearly 2 million Vue. J downloads in November 2020.

Xiaomi and Alibaba highly value Vue.js among software developers. It is user-friendly, highly customizable, and easily integrates with other frameworks. With Vue.js, software developers can create user interfaces and single-page applications. It is much easier to use than Angular, so application developers often prefer to use Vue to build their web solutions.

According to Web Technology Surveys, the use of Vue.js is growing. It is now easy to find a Vue.js development company ready to provide you with efficient and stable applications developed with this framework. Therefore, we expect that Vue.js will most likely stay with us in 2021.

#4 AngularJS will continue to grow

AngularJS is one of the most comprehensive JavaScript frameworks that remains popular among software developers. Although it can be slow to deploy and may seem cumbersome, it offers thought-out sound features with MVC architecture to build robust single-page applications.

In 2019, the eighth edition of this framework release with valuable extra features.

 It included differential loading and lazy loading to make web applications faster, the ability to create web workers with the CLI to improve web development, a new deprecation guide for developers to more easily track the use of functions and APIs, and much more.

Stack Overflow ranks this framework as the 3rd most attractive among web development frameworks. And it was Built With claims that there are about 3.7 million sites built in Angular worldwide.

#5 PWAs are becoming more and more popular

PWAs are becoming more and more popular, and more companies are willing to develop them. According to Statista, 24% of e-commerce companies plan to invest in PWAs, while 11% are already using them.

Progressive Web Apps (PWAs) are available on wireless devices such as mobile phones and tablets. They work like traditional websites, although they behave like mobile apps. Software developers use web-building technologies such as HTML, CSS, and JavaScript to develop PWAs.

PWAs have several advantages. They are cross-platform, adapt quickly to different screen sizes, update automatically, work offline, create secure connections for data exchange, and many other features.

Some companies have already tried PWAs and were satisfied with the results: Uber, Twitter, and Pinterest are among them. They have managed to attract more customers, increase revenue from monthly visits, and much more.

#6 SPAs are gaining ground.

Single-page applications (SPAs) are the new way to browse websites on wireless gadgets. SPAs allow users to browse web pages without reloading them, resulting in a more dynamic experience.

To create SPAs, web developers use standard web technologies such as JavaScript, HTML, CSS, AngularJS, React.js, or Vue.js. The most famous examples of SPAs are LinkedIn, Airbnb, Facebook, Gmail, and others.

Other benefits of SPAs that will make them trendy in 2021 are

  • Extended battery life;

  • Improved user experience;

  • Fast site navigation;

  • Improved caching;

  • Ease of development and maintenance.

#7 AMP increases download speeds.

According to Web Technology Surveys, AMP sites are growing in popularity. The trend continues to grow, and we expect AMP's influence to grow even more by 2021.

Google developed the Accelerated Mobile Pages technology to make downloading websites faster. To do this, Google provides software developers with ready-to-use, unmodifiable JavaScript code, as well as HTML and CSS frameworks. Google restricts the use of customized JavaScript in AMP pages, as it often slows downloading speed.

Several sites already use AMP, including Twitter, The Guardian, CNBC, Gizmodo, and others.

In addition to fast loading pages, AMP has a few other advantages:

  • SEO improvement, as Google prefers AMP pages;

  • users spend more time on the page because they don't have to wait long for the page to load;

  • Improved monetization due to better usability of images and banners in the HTML code;

  • easier to be noticed as Google presents pages in the Google Search Top Stories carousel, resulting in AMP content appearing first in Google search.
